About the designer
Launched in 2016 by Florentine designer Barbara Borghini, GIA Borghini shoes are entirely handmade by artisans in nearby Tuscany. With an emphasis on feminine details, the luxury brand’s slides, boots, and sandals are made for all-day comfort and enduring style.
